This process involves not only the labeling of criminally deviant behavior, which is behavior that does not fit socially constructed norms, but also labeling that which reflects stereotyped or stigmatized behavior of the mentally ill. The labeling theory was first applied to the term mentally ill in 1966 whenThomas J. ScheffpublishedBeing Mentally Ill. Scheff challenged common perceptions ofmental disordersby claiming that mental disorder is manifested solely as a result of societal influence. The DSM-II, released in 1968, attempted to incorporate the psychiatric knowledge of the day. In 1949, the World Health Organization released its sixth edition of the International Classification of Diseases (ICD), which for the first time included mental illnesses. Labelingoccurs when information about a persons diagnostic classification is communicated in a negative manner that leads to stigma for the individual with a mental disorder. Critics note that 69% of DSM-5 task force members had direct ties to the pharmaceutical industry. This method offers a number of advantages, such as standardization of diagnoses across different treatment providers. However, the classification systems make it challenging to see patients as individuals with a range of history and symptoms, and that means things can be missed.
